Auryn Resources halts work at Sombrero copper project in Peru

March 19, 2020 / www.metalbulletin.com / Article Link

Auryn Resources Inc, which is developing the Sombrero copper-gold project in southern Peru, has halted work after recalling all personnel from the field due to the novel coronavirus (2019-nCoV) pandemic, the company said.

The decision was made prior to the Peruvian government mandating a temporary two-week border lockdown, with all work at public institutions also suspended for 15 days.
